掌握编程语言的核心思维模式.pdf

  1. 1、本文档共4页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

编程语言是现代世界中不可或缺的一部分,掌握编程语言的核心思

维模式是成为一名优秀程序员的重要基础。本文将探讨如何掌握编程

语言的核心思维模式,并介绍几种常见的编程语言的思维模式。通过

学习和理解这些核心思维模式,读者将能够更加高效地编写代码,提

高自己的编程技能。

一、什么是编程语言的核心思维模式

在学习任何一门编程语言之前,我们需要了解编程语言的核心思维

模式。编程语言的核心思维模式是指一种以解决问题为导向的思维方

式,它帮助程序员理解并使用编程语言的各种特性和功能来解决现实

世界中的具体问题。

不同的编程语言有不同的核心思维模式,但它们通常包括以下几个

方面:

1.抽象和模块化:编程语言的核心思维模式强调抽象和模块化的能

力。程序员需要将复杂的问题抽象成简单的模块,并通过模块之间的

合理组织和协作来解决问题。

2.逻辑思维和算法设计:编程语言的核心思维模式要求具备良好的

逻辑思维能力和算法设计能力。程序员需要能够理解和设计符合逻辑

的算法,并将其转化为具体的代码实现。

合规范的代码,并注重代码的可读性。规范化的代码和良好的可读性

可以提高代码的可维护性和可扩展性。

4.实践和经验积累:编程语言的核心思维模式要求程序员通过大量

的实践和经验积累来提高自己的编程能力。只有不断地实践和积累经

验,才能更好地掌握编程语言的核心思维模式。

二、常见编程语言的核心思维模式

不同的编程语言有不同的核心思维模式。下面介绍几种常见的编程

语言的核心思维模式。

1.面向过程编程(C语言):

面向过程编程是一种较为基础的编程思维模式。它侧重于将问题拆

分为多个步骤,通过顺序执行这些步骤来解决问题。C语言是一种典

型的面向过程编程语言,它的核心思维模式是通过函数的调用实现逻

辑的封装和模块化。

2.面向对象编程(Java语言):

面向对象编程是一种更高级的编程思维模式。它将问题归纳为多个

对象,通过对象之间的交互来解决问题。Java语言是一种常用的面向

对象编程语言,它的核心思维模式是封装、继承和多态。

3.函数式编程(Python语言):

式。语言是一种支持函数式编程的语言,它的核心思维模式是

函数的高阶操作和不可变性。

三、如何掌握编程语言的核心思维模式

掌握编程语言的核心思维模式需要长期的学习和实践。以下是几个

掌握编程语言核心思维模式的方法。

1.学习理论知识:了解编程语言的核心思维模式的理论基础是非常

重要的。通过学习编程语言的相关教材、资料和大量的练习,可以帮

助我们理解编程语言的核心思维模式。

2.阅读源代码:阅读源代码是学习和理解编程语言的核心思维模式

的一种有效方法。通过阅读优秀的开源项目地源代码,我们可以学习

到其他程序员在实践中如何运用核心思维模式来解决问题。

3.参与实际项目:参与实际项目是提高编程能力的重要途径。通过

参与实际项目,我们可以将理论知识应用到实践中,从而更好地掌握

编程语言的核心思维模式。

4.不断练习和积累经验:编程是一门实践性很强的学科,只有不断

地练习和积累经验,才能更好地掌握编程语言的核心思维模式。通过

编写各种类型的程序,我们可以提高自己的编程能力,并逐步掌握编

程语言的核心思维模式。

总结:

通过学习和理解编程语言的核心思维模式,我们能够更加高效地编写

代码,提高自己的编程技能。无论是面向过程编程、面向对象编程还

是函数式编程,只要我们不断地学习和实践,就能够掌握编程语言的

核心思维模式,并编写出高质量的代码。

文档评论(0)

各类考试卷精编 + 关注
官方认证
内容提供者

各类考试卷、真题卷

认证主体社旗县兴中文具店(个体工商户)
IP属地河南
统一社会信用代码/组织机构代码
92411327MAD627N96D

1亿VIP精品文档

相关文档